1. Austin To San Antonio, Texas – BBQ, Tacos & Tex-Mex

Nothing says Texas like the sizzle of a barbecue pit, and this road trip offers plenty of it. Just a short drive separates these two cities, but the journey is packed with iconic flavors. Sink your teeth into brisket at Black’s BBQ in Lockhart, known as the BBQ Capital of Texas.

Relish the perfect blend of spices in a taco from Torchy’s Tacos, where creativity meets tradition. Don’t miss the bold Tex-Mex flavors at Rosario’s in San Antonio, where dishes like enchiladas and queso flameado steal the show.

2. New Orleans To Lafayette, Louisiana – Cajun, Creole & Beignets

The vibrant flavors of the South await on this tantalizing route. Your taste buds will dance with delight as you sample gumbo at Galatoire’s in New Orleans, a Creole classic that’s rich and satisfying.

Journey onward to Café du Monde for their world-famous beignets, a sweet treat that perfectly complements a chicory coffee. In Lafayette, indulge in a crawfish étouffée at Prejean’s, where the Cajun spices bring the dish to life..

12. Boston To Portland, Maine – Lobster Rolls, Clam Chowder & Coastal Treats

New England’s coastal flavors are a seafood lover’s dream. Start your drive with a bowl of clam chowder at Union Oyster House in Boston, a creamy and comforting delight.

As you head north, savor a lobster roll at Red’s Eats in Wiscasset, where the lobster is fresh and succulent. Finish your journey with a blueberry pie from Two Fat Cats Bakery in Portland, a sweet taste of Maine’s bounty.
